    Sled Dog Snoopy

    A warning from the top: don't come to this Peanuts special looking for humor and a lot of laughs. This really doesn't have many, but that doesn't mean it's not worthwhile. It's more serious in tone, perhaps the most drama-like Peanuts episode to this point in time (1978).

    The plot is simple: It's February, snow is on the ground, and Charlie Brown tries to get Snoopy to drag his sleigh, like an Arctic sled dog might; Snoopy is having none of it, and in fact it's Charlie who winds up pulling the sleigh. After this, Snoopy settles down to sleep and has a nightmare (thus the title of the special). His dream, which makes up the bulk of the episode, is that he is now somewhere in the Yukon and has been forcibly added to an unseen man's team of sled dogs.

    Being a beagle, Snoopy struggles to adjust to this new kind of life, and it only gets worse because the other dogs not only don't accept him, but are outwardly hostile towards him. Yet he must somehow persevere under the harsh weather conditions, the relentless crack of the whip, and undernourishment. It really is the stuff of nightmares for a domesticated beagle!

    There is one funny scene in the middle of the dream that has Snoopy in a saloon. But after that it's back to the sled team before things come to a final climax that wakes him from the nightmare. It's definitely a departure from the usual Peanuts fare, but again, that doesn't make it bad. If you can adjust your expectations you just might enjoy it for what it is.

    7/10. A different kind of Peanut. But not bad at all. Would I watch again (Y/N)?: Yes.

    Did you know

    Edit
    • Trivia
      With just Charlie Brown and Snoopy, this Peanuts special has the lowest number of major characters, as well as the lowest number of spoken lines.
    • Goofs
      Snoopy makes only two pizzas, but when he returns to the oven there are four visible. When he stacks them, there are five, then when he brings them to the table, there are six, but when Charlie Brown decides something is wrong with him, there are five again.
